LADY SENATORS SEASON ENDS IN FIRST ROUND OF NATIONALS

The Lady Senators couldn't shake off a cold start in the first round of the Women's National Tournament.  They found themselves in a 41-29 hole after the first twenty minutes, and could never make a run in the second half.  Tyler would hold off to advance with a 72-60 win.  the Lady Senators saw their season end with a 13-4 overall record.  

The Lady Senators would shoot only 28.1% from the field for the game while their opponents managed only 40% from the field.  Other than the shooting woes, the squads were evenly matched in all other key categories.  Walters would hold a 2 point lead midway through the first quarter before Tyler would respond with 14-7 run to take a 19-14 lead.  The Lady Senators were outscored int he second quarter 22-15 to build the 12 point cushion Tyler would hold for the rest of the game.  

Quentarra Mitchell led Walters with 17 points and a team high twelve rebounds.  Blayre Shultz also reached double figures with 12 points.
